Engineering Washington, District Of ColumbiaWind River is a
global leader in delivering software for mission-critical
intelligent systems. For more than four decades, the company has
been an innovator and pioneer, powering billions of systems that
require the highest levels of security, safety, and
reliability.Wind River helps customers across automotive,
aerospace, defense, industrial, medical, and telecommunications
industries solve complex technology challenges on their journey
toward the new intelligent machine economy. The company's software
powers generation after generation of the safest, most secure
systems in the world. Examples include playing a key role in NASA
space missions such as Artemis I, the James Webb Space Telescope,
and multiple Mars rovers. We've achieved recent 5G milestones
including the world's first successful 5G data session with Verizon
and building one of the largest Open RAN networks in the world with
Vodafone.The company has received industry recognition for its
technology innovation and leadership, and for its workplace
culture, including global Great Place to Work certification and
being named a "Top Workplace" for ten consecutive years. If you
want to be part of a unique culture where the lived experience is
based on our cultural attributes of growth mindset, customer-focus,
and diversity, equity, inclusion & belonging, come join us and help
advance the future software defined world.Wind River Systems, a
subsidiary of Aptiv PLC, is a California-based software company
which develops embedded systems and cloud software consisting of
real time operating systems (RTOS), industry-specific software,
simulation technology, development tools and middleware.This new
